PCM的步骤及各步骤的作用
时间: 2024-04-28 20:25:15 浏览: 17
PCM(Pulse Code Modulation)是一种数字信号处理技术,其步骤和作用如下:
1. 采样(Sampling):对模拟信号进行采样,将连续的模拟信号转换为离散的数字信号。采样的频率越高,转换后的数字信号越接近原始模拟信号。
2. 量化(Quantization):将采样后的信号转换为一系列离散的数值,从而将连续的模拟信号转换为离散的数字信号。量化的精度越高,转换后的数字信号越接近原始模拟信号。
3. 编码(Coding):将量化后的数字信号进行编码,将每个离散数值表示为一定比特数的二进制数码,从而将离散的数字信号转换为二进制数字信号。
这些步骤的作用是将模拟信号转换为数字信号,以便数字信号能够在数字系统中进行处理和传输。同时,采样、量化和编码的精度影响着数字信号的质量和精度。因此,在实际应用中,需要根据实际需求确定采样频率和量化精度等参数,以保证数字信号的质量和精度。
相关问题
叙述PCM编解码的基本步骤
PCM(Pulse Code Modulation)是一种数字信号编码方式,它将模拟信号转换为数字信号,从而实现数字信号处理和传输。PCM编解码的基本步骤如下:
1. 采样:将模拟信号按照一定的时间间隔进行采样,将采样的模拟信号转换成离散的数字信号。
2. 量化:将采样后的数字信号分成若干个离散的电平,将每个电平对应成一个数字,从而将连续的模拟信号转换成离散的数字信号。
3. 编码:将量化后的数字信号进行编码,将每个数字编码成二进制码,从而得到PCM码流。
4. 解码:将PCM码流进行解码,将二进制码转换成数字信号,从而得到原始的量化后的数字信号。
5. 重构:将解码后的数字信号进行重构,将离散的数字信号转换成连续的模拟信号,从而得到原始的模拟信号。
通过这些步骤,PCM编解码可以将模拟信号转换成数字信号,并在数字信号处理和传输中起到重要的作用。
pcm系统设计及matlab仿真实现
PCM系统是一种数字信号处理技术,用于将模拟信号转换为数字信号。其设计包括采样、量化和编码三个步骤。采样是将模拟信号离散化,量化是将采样信号的幅度离散化,编码是将量化后的信号转换为二进制码。MATLAB可以用于实现PCM系统的仿真,通过编写程序模拟PCM系统的各个步骤,可以得到系统的性能指标,如信噪比、失真度等。